House powerwashing services involve the use of high-pressure water streams to clean the exterior surfaces of a home. This process effectively removes dirt, grime, mold, algae, and other buildup that can accumulate over time. Powerwashing is a practical way to restore the appearance of a home’s siding, brick, stucco, or wood surfaces, making them look fresh and well-maintained. The service is typically performed with specialized equipment that allows contractors to adjust pressure levels to suit different materials, ensuring thorough cleaning without damaging the property.

Powerwashing addresses common problems such as mold and mildew growth, which can cause discoloration and potentially affect the integrity of exterior surfaces. It also helps eliminate stubborn stains, moss, and algae that can develop in shaded or damp areas. Regular powerwashing can prevent the buildup of harmful substances that may lead to rot, decay, or damage over time. Homeowners often consider powerwashing as part of routine maintenance or before painting and sealing projects to ensure surfaces are clean and receptive to coatings.

This service is suitable for a wide range of property types, including single-family homes, townhouses, condos, and multi-unit buildings. It is particularly popular among homeowners looking to boost curb appeal, prepare for selling a property, or simply keep their exteriors looking their best. Powerwashing can be used on various surfaces such as siding, decks, fences, driveways, and walkways. Whether a property has vinyl siding, brick veneer, or wood accents, local service providers can tailor their approach to meet the specific cleaning needs of each surface.

The overview below groups typical House Powerwashing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Basic House Washing - typical costs range from $250-$600 for many smaller or routine jobs. Most projects fall within this middle range, depending on the size of the home and level of dirt buildup.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um.

Deck and Patio Cleaning - local contractors often charge between $150-$500 for cleaning decks or patios. Smaller, less complex surfaces tend to be at the lower end, while larger or heavily stained areas can push toward the higher range.

Exterior Window and Siding Cleaning - expect costs to typically fall between $200-$700 for many homes. Routine cleaning often lands in the middle of this range, with more extensive or multi-story projects potentially exceeding $700.

Full Exterior Powerwashing - larger, more comprehensive projects can reach $1,000-$5,000+ depending on property size and complexity. Many residential jobs are in the $1,000-$2,500 range, while extensive commercial or multi-building projects are at the higher end.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ing house powerwashing service providers, it’s important to consider their experience with projects similar to your own. Look for local contractors who have a proven track record of handling homes like yours, whether that involves delicate siding, large decks, or specific surface materials. A contractor’s familiarity with the particular challenges of your home type can help ensure the work is performed effectively and safely, reducing the risk of damage or subpar results.

Clear, written expectations are essential when selecting a powerwashing service. Reputable local contractors should be able to provide detailed descriptions of their services, including what surfaces will be cleaned, the methods used, and any preparations or precautions needed. Having these details in writing helps establish a shared understanding of the scope of work and prevents misunderstandings, making it easier to evaluate whether a service provider’s approach aligns with your needs.

Reputable references and strong communication are key indicators of a reliable powerwashing service. Ask potential local pros for references from past clients who had similar projects, and take the time to contact them if possible. Good communication throughout the process - including prompt responses to questions and transparency about procedures - can make the entire experience smoother. What surfaces can house powerwashing clean? House powerwashing typically cleans exterior surfaces such as siding, decks, driveways, and patios, helping to remove dirt, mold, and grime.

Is house powerwashing safe for my home's exterior? When performed by experienced service providers, house powerwashing is generally safe and can help maintain the integrity of exterior surfaces.

How often should I have my house powerwashed? The frequency of powerwashing depends on local climate and environmental factors, but many homeowners opt for annual or bi-annual cleaning.

What are the benefits of hiring local contractors for house powerwashing? Local contractors understand regional conditions and can provide tailored services to meet specific exterior cleaning needs.

What types of equipment do house powerwashing service providers use? They typically use high-pressure washers with various nozzles and cleaning solutions suitable for different exterior surfaces.
